In a new statement, Hamas has said that Israel continues to prevent the entry of humanitarian aid and basic materials into the Gaza Strip. The Palestinian group called the closure of the crossings into Gaza a violation of the ceasefire agreement and of international law that threatened the lives of innocent civilians. “We call on the mediators to pressure the occupation to abide by its commitments and open the crossings immediately, to ensure the flow of humanitarian aid and end the policy of collective punishment pursued by the occupation authorities against our people,” Hamas said.
